抄録
Bivalent metal salts, such as Zn, Mg, Mn, Cd etc. of 6-benzamido-4-methoxy-m-toluidine diazonium chloride are more stable than its free diazonium chloride. These salts react easily with oxalacetate at room temperature in alkaline medium to form the colour substance having the maximum optical density at 520 mμ. Using these zinc salts as the colour developing reagents for oxalacetate, we established the routine assay method of glutamic-oxalacetic transaminase, and malic dehydrogenase activities in serum. Upon measuring GOT activity in serum of patients by three different methods (diazonium salt method, Karmen method and Reitman・Frankel method), we came to a conclusion that this new diazonium method was very advantageous to Reitman・Frankel method in accuracy and simplicity for clinicians.
